It was at the London Motor Show in September 1962 that MG unveiled the replacement for the MGA: the MGB. More modern, its design was sleeker, more angular and adopted a more contemporary look. With the addition of side windows in the doors, the MGB abandoned its status as a pure roadster to become a true convertible. Much less spartan than its predecessor, it offered a more spacious interior, still strictly two-seater, but designed for greater comfort without compromising the brand's sporting spirit.
Elegant in both town and country, the MGB appeals with its versatility and assertive personality. Its engine also gained in displacement, increasing from 1600 to 1800 cc, bringing extra performance and enjoyment.
The example we are offering was first registered on 14 June 1968. It is therefore a desirable MK2 version, which retains the charm of the early models while benefiting from significant technical developments: fully synchronised gearbox, five-bearing engine, alternator and standard heating.
Restored by its owner in the mid-2000s, this MGB now has a beautiful patina. It has been little used in recent years, so a minor service may be considered for peace of mind, although it is currently in working order. A spot of perforating corrosion, a bearing and the brakes will need to be checked to obtain a valid MOT.
Apart from its MGC bonnet, it is faithful to the original and perfectly embodies the timeless charm of the classic English convertible.
